ROH Champ Nigel McGuinness Won't Fight This Weekend

Source: ROH's Dr. Keith Lipinski
I just got off the phone with Nigel McGuinness and there is good and bad news. The bad news is that Nigel has a torn left bicep. The good news is the doctors think with some rest that he will not need surgery and that it will heal by “Final Battle” weekend at the end of December. Since Nigel has already made his first defense we will keep the belt on Nigel until “Final Battle” weekend. If Nigel is unable to compete by the end of Decemember then we might have to make a move with the belt.
Nigel wants to send his apologies for not being able to compete this weekend. I have to admit that it was a hard conversation with him. Let me assure you that there is nothing in the world that Nigel wants more than to be able to give you great World Title matches this weekend. He has worked his entire life to get to this spot and this is just terrible luck. However, it is for the best that Nigel uses this time to heal so he can be 100% when his World Title reign resumes. Nigel will be available for autographs before both the Philly and NYC events this weekend.
We apologize for the lineup change. We will have something posted soon with revised lineups for this weekend and huge news about “Final Battle” weekend. Thank you for your understanding during these difficult circumstances. We assure you that we will deliver two epic events this weekend. Thank you.
